49ers-Jets inactives: Joe Staley to miss first game since 2010

The San Francisco 49ers and New York Jets released their Week 14 inactives, and as expected, left tackle Joe Staley is inactive. Staley suffered a hamstring injury during practice on Wednesday, and will see his 92-game active streak snapped.

His absence means Zane Beadles moves from left guard to left tackle. Andrew Tiller will move into the lineup at left guard. Beadles last played a game at tackle in his rookie season, when he filled in at right tackle. The interior of the line is intriguing with Tiller joining center Daniel Kilgore and right guard Joshua Garnett, but the left end will be something to watch.
